Needs a Better Band July 30, 2008 The idea of a Guitar Hero game centered around a particular band isn't a bad one, but then you need a band with a deeper playbook than Aerosmith to keep things interesting.
That's the big problem with this edition of the Guitar Hero franchise: there's just not that much good music here. There are maybe three good Aerosmith tunes, an old Kinks song, and then what do you have? Ted "Raw Meat" Nugent -- yuck!
There is some slight amusement value in seeing an animated Steve Tyler looking like Mother in Psycho, or listening to the band reminisce about the highlights of their rehab-riddled career, like Spinal Tap 40 years on.
Really, it's time to try this with a band that would keep you rocking track after track, like the Beatles or the Stones or Tom Petty or -- well, someone good, yaknow?

Ok if you love Aerosmith July 25, 2008 I purchased the game for my father-in-law and played it before I gave it to him (yes I am a horrible person.) I finished the game in about 2 hours and really felt bad about the experience.
There are only a handful of Aerosmith songs on the game. From the huge catalog they have they also chose some odd ones, and left out most of teh port reunion songs that truly rock.
I remember one early preview of the game whare the GH folks said one of the innovations to this game was that there was now five people on stage, and I completly agree that that is the only innovation of this game. Wait until the price drops to about twenty dollars and you would be a ok buying the game for the number of songs on it.
The band interviews are interesting, however they are way to short and on the PS2 look crappy.
